ECOPA participates in International Tax Dialogue
Istanbul, Turkey
Charles Vellutini, Managing Director of ECOPA, joined tax administrators and senior officials from 15 countries throughout Europe and Asia, to share experiences and lessons learned from both implementation and operation of risk-based tax assessment systems. Risk-based audit is a key element of modernizing tax administration in the region, and various systems are either being implemented or developed by several CIS countries. In partnership with the World Bank Group and International Tax Dialogue (ITD), the purpose of the conference is to bring together these practitioners to establish a forum for future cooperation.
